About the role
- Manage the project information model for sharing with the project team and authorising with the client team aligned with project/contract exchange and security protocols.
- Ensure the project/contracts standard methods and procedures align with BAM’s ISO 19650 protocols.
- Ensure model coordination and mobilisation plan are in place and carry out regular reviews.
- Ensure that all parties are using the CDE in the agreed manner, as described in the BAM information protocol, client requirements, and that it is aligned with ISO 19650 (where required).
- Ensure that the building information model meets the required data quality (graphical and non graphical) and the correct level of information need is delivered. Carry out reporting as required.
- Manage the creation of the project information model and review the quality of data produced from the task teams and report non-conformances.
- Lead the implementation of digital processes on projects/contracts in all stages of the asset lifecycle as required.
- Establish compliant workflows in accordance with Client requirements, BAM’s information protocol, and ISO 19650 (where required), ensuring that they are planned, documented, and well communicated.
- Contribute to the development of the Master Information Delivery Plan (MIDP) and Task Information Delivery Plan (TIDP).
- Collaborate with IT and wider DPS to ensure that digital systems and working methods that are fit for purpose and efficient for the relevant stage of the project/asset lifecycle.
- Understand the technical challenges the users are facing with respect to application or tool usage, and quickly resolve the issues to avoid effect on productivity and performance.
- Contribute to and maintain the BIM execution plan (pre and post contract BEP), and relevant other documents associated with BAM’s information protocol.
- Support the management of the risk register during the project/contract life cycle.
Requirements
- Working knowledge of ISO19650
- 3-5 years' experience in digital construction / digital facilities management, familiar with industry and tendering processes.
- Higher education in construction or related fields, or equivalent experience.
- Good communication, time management skills and a collaborative team player.
